About Oil, Gas & Energy Law in Estonia

Estonia's oil, gas, and energy sector is critical for the country's economy and energy security. While Estonia is not a prominent oil producer, it is known for its oil shale industry, which plays a significant role in energy production. In terms of gas, Estonia relies heavily on imports, as the country is part of the Baltic energy market. The transition towards renewable energy sources is also a growing focus, with legislative frameworks gradually being developed to accommodate this shift. The sector is governed by various national and EU regulations that oversee environmental protection, sustainable development, and market competition.

Local Laws Overview

Oil, gas, and energy laws in Estonia are influenced by the country's commitment to the European Union's energy policies, focusing on energy efficiency, market integrity, and environmental sustainability. Key legislative frameworks include:

  • Energy Market Act: Governs the production, distribution, and supply of electricity and gas.
  • Electricity Market Act: Regulates the operation of the electricity market, ensuring fair competition and consumer protection.
  • Natural Gas Act: Provides regulations specific to natural gas market operations.
  • Environmental Impact Assessment Act: Ensures that potential environmental impacts are assessed before energy projects are approved.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the primary source of energy production in Estonia?

Estonia primarily uses oil shale for energy production, making it unique among European nations.

Are there incentives for renewable energy projects in Estonia?

Yes, Estonia offers various incentives, including subsidies and tax benefits, to support renewable energy projects.

How does Estonia ensure energy security?

Estonia is part of the Baltic energy market and collaborates with neighboring countries to ensure a reliable energy supply.

What role do EU regulations play in Estonia's energy sector?

EU regulations heavily influence Estonia's energy sector, especially concerning sustainability and market regulation.

Can foreign companies invest in Estonia's energy sector?

Yes, foreign investment is welcome, and Estonia has a favorable legal framework for foreign investors in the energy sector.

How is gas regulated in Estonia?

The Natural Gas Act regulates gas market operations, including import, supply, and distribution activities.

What environmental regulations affect the energy sector in Estonia?

Estonia's Environmental Impact Assessment Act ensures that energy projects adhere to environmental standards before approval.

Is Estonia moving towards renewable energy sources?

Yes, Estonia is gradually transitioning to renewable energy, with increasing investments in wind and solar power.

What legal challenges affect energy companies in Estonia?

Common challenges include navigating complex regulatory requirements, environmental compliance, and land use disputes.

How does one resolve a legal dispute in the energy sector?

Disputes are typically resolved through negotiation, arbitration, or court proceedings, depending on the nature of the issue.
